I don’t know if you still have this problem, but after some trials and errors I guess I found out what’s causing the problem. It happened to me too…
I’m modelling a character with multiple subtools, all have UVs and follow the same principle (low to high poly, at the moment I’ve deleted some of the high-res levels and I’m at SubD 4).
I’ve managed to merged almost all the subtools without having problems, but there are two substools that are those that are causing the problem.
Try to follow these steps:
-
If you have multiple subtools merged correctly with subdivisions preserved, try this: Geometry > Meshintegrity > Check Mesh Integrity. It should say to you “Mesh integrity test completed successfully”.
-
Try now to do it on a subtools that you think is causing the problem, it should tells you that there is error in the mesh. To me it says “The mesh contains 1156 out-of-bounds UV coordinates. The mesh contains 576 edges that are shared by more than two polygons”.
This is what you have to fixed in order to proceed and merged all the subtools correctly.
